Mayhem, mischief and Moliére. This modern adaptation keeps the original structure of the popular French playwright's classic farce, but adds fresh, topical, and contemporary humor ("Moliére didn't write this part"). Brimming with zany characters and improvisation and led by the hilarious and crafty servant Scapin, this play is an uproarious romp of hugely theatrical
proportions.
